BM25 Best Match 25
Classic lexical search ranking algorithm — TF-IDF with saturation and length normalisation. The standard in Elasticsearch, Lucene, Postgres FTS.
Developed in the 1980s by Stephen Robertson et al. (the Okapi project at City, University of London). "Probabilistic relevance framework". Saturates term frequency so 100 occurrences of "the" don't weigh 100× more than 10. Normalises for document length. Despite its age, BM25 is often comparable to or better than naive vector search for specific domains (code, legal, medical with exact terms). Hybrid search (BM25 + vector + reranker) is best practice in modern RAG systems.
